Xunlei's total revenue in 2016 was US$157 million, and its cloud computing revenue increased by 230.4% year-on-year

On March 8, Beijing time, Xunlei released its unaudited financial report for the fourth quarter and the full year ending December 31, 2016. The financial report shows that Xunlei's total revenue for the whole year of 2016 was US$157 million, a year-on-year increase of 20.7%. The revenue growth was due to the growth of membership income, mobile advertising and cloud computing business. Among them, Xunlei's strategic business cloud computing had a year-on-year revenue increase of 230.4% in 2016.

Specific figures in the financial report show that Thunder's total revenue in 2016 was US$157 million, a year-on-year increase of 20.7%; membership revenue was US$90.2 million, a year-on-year increase of 9.4%; Internet advertising revenue was US$16.9 million, a year-on-year increase of 252.2%; other Internet value-added service revenue including cloud computing business was US$49.9 million, a year-on-year increase of 16.7%.

Xunlei's membership revenue in 2016 was US$90.2 million, a year-on-year increase of 9.4%. The growth in membership revenue came from the increase in average income per member. As of December 31, 2016, Xunlei's average income per member was RMB 30.1, compared with RMB 25.3 in the same period of 2015, a year-on-year increase of 19%. The reorganization of the membership system, the launch of super members with more privileges, and the continuous operation of the Xunlei team have increased Xunlei's average income per user in 2016, which has helped Xunlei's membership revenue maintain a steady growth. The steady growth of the main business is an important guarantee for Xunlei's continued healthy development.

Internet advertising revenue, including mobile advertising revenue, was $16.9 million in 2016, up 252.2% year-on-year; the revenue growth was due to the growth of mobile advertising. Through continuous product improvement, Xunlei Mobile now covers short videos, live broadcasts, downloads and other functions, attracting a large number of users and becoming a favorite mobile entertainment consumption APP for users, with the number of users and traffic constantly reaching new highs.

In 2016, revenue from other Internet value-added services (IVAS), including cloud computing business, was US$49.9 million, a year-on-year increase of 16.7%. Since the cloud computing business achieved revenue in the third quarter of 2015, it has been in a state of rapid development, and both the bandwidth sales business and the number of CDN customers have maintained a rapid growth momentum. As a leader in innovative professional CDN, Star Domain CDN promoted the advancement of CDN technology in the field of cloud computing CDN applications in 2016. While revolutionizing the CDN industry, it also had a huge impact on the CDN application industry, especially the live broadcast industry, which is in a period of rapid development. So far, Star Domain CDN has provided services to hundreds of live broadcast companies such as Xiaomi, iQiyi, Panda Live, bilibili, Momo, Chushou, Zhanqi Live, Dapeng VR, GoGal, etc., and has become a trusted technology service provider for corporate live broadcasts.

Xunlei estimates that total revenue for the first quarter of 2017 will be between US$39 million and US$41 million, which represents a mid-term year-over-year growth of 4%. This outlook reflects Xunlei's preliminary views and is subject to change in the future.
